Understanding Composite Doors
Composite doors are made from a combination of materials, generally including wood, plastic, and sometimes metal. This mix deals numerous advantages:
- Durability: Composite doors are resistant to warping, cracking, and rotting.
- Security: They are extremely secure due to their robust building and multi-point locking systems.
- Energy Efficiency: The materials utilized in composite doors offer excellent insulation, assisting to decrease heating & cooling expenses.
- Looks: They can imitate the appearance of traditional wood doors while requiring less maintenance.
Typical Composite Door Issues
Before diving into repair methods, it’s important to determine common issues that might need professional attention:
- Cracks and Chips: Minor damage can occur due to effect or weathering.
- Distorted Panels: Exposure to extreme temperature levels or humidity can trigger panels to warp.
- Locking Mechanism Problems: The locking system can end up being malfunctioning, impacting the door’s security.
- Seal Deterioration: The weatherstripping and seals can wear, resulting in drafts and energy loss.
- Hinge Issues: Loose or rusted hinges can affect the door’s alignment and operation.
Professional Repair Methods
When it comes to composite door maintenance service door repair, professional knowledge is typically needed to guarantee the job is done properly. Here are some common repair approaches:
-
Repairing Cracks and Chips
- Assessment: A professional will evaluate the degree of the damage to figure out if a repair is feasible.
- Preparation: The damaged area is cleaned and gotten ready for repair.
- Filling: A specialized filler is utilized to complete the cracks or chips.
- Completing: The repaired location is sanded smooth and painted or stained to match the remainder of the door.
-
Dealing With Warped Panels
- Diagnosis: A professional will determine the reason for the warping, which might be due to wetness or temperature level modifications.
- Adjustment: In some cases, the door can be gotten used to fix the positioning.
- Replacement: If the warping is extreme, the panel or the whole door might require to be replaced.
-
Repairing Locking Mechanism Problems
- Assessment: The locking system is completely examined to determine the concern.
- Lubrication: Moving parts are lubed to ensure smooth operation.
- Replacement: Faulty components are replaced with brand-new ones.
- Testing: The lock is evaluated to guarantee it functions correctly.
-
Changing Seals and Weatherstripping
- Removal: Old, weakened seals are thoroughly removed.
- Measurement: New seals are determined and cut to fit the door.
- Installation: The new seals are installed, guaranteeing a tight fit.
- Sealing: Any spaces are sealed to prevent drafts and moisture invasion.
-
Resolving Hinge Issues
- Tightening: Loose hinges are tightened up with screws.
- Lubrication: Hinges are oiled to reduce friction and noise.
- Replacement: If hinges are seriously rusted or damaged, they are changed with brand-new ones.
Maintenance Tips
Routine maintenance can significantly extend the life of a composite door repair near me door and prevent the requirement for major repairs. Here are some maintenance ideas:
- Clean Regularly: Use a mild detergent and water to clean the door surface.
- Examine Seals: Check the weatherstripping and seals for wear and tear.
- Lubricate Moving Parts: Apply lubricant to hinges and the locking mechanism.
- Look for Damage: Regularly examine the door for indications of damage and address problems promptly.
- Preserve Proper Alignment: Ensure the door is properly lined up to avoid warping and sticking.
